Introduction
Taking care of your private parts is as important as doing so with your face and the other parts of your body. Otherwise, it can lead to infection. The most common consequences of improper hygiene are bacterial and fungal infections, which usually appear together. If someone has this issue, there will be itching, burning, pain, redness, swelling, or yellowish discharge.
Questions about genital health
1. Are these infections sexually transmitted?
All of these infections can be transmitted by sexual contact without using adequate protection especially condoms.
2. How are infections of the genitals treated?
It depends on person to person, as well as the severity of the infection. Preparations that are most commonly used to treat infections are creams for men and vaginal tablets for women.
3. Are water and soap sufficient for daily hygiene?
It is enough. It is recommended to use as a weaker soap, glycerin or baby soap are the best since they are neutral.
4. There are gels and other products for intimate hygiene. Should they be used?
It is a matter of choice, but if you decide to use them, choose the ones with a pH between 5.5 and 6. This pH value does not interfere with the normal environment of the genitals and the bacterium that protects it.
5. In certain circumstances, especially when we travel, we clean the intimate parts by using wet wipes. Is it harmful?
It is not harmful if it is occasionally used, but nevertheless, these handkerchiefs disturb the natural flora, especially if they have fragrance and other accessories. It can happen that wet wipes cause allergy or some type of skin irritation, but that is not often the case.
6. How important is the material of underwear?
Surely, it is better to wear cotton underwear, primarily because it can be washed at 90 degrees Celsius.
7. Is there a greater risk of infection during the menstrual cycle?
Blood is the ideal medium for bacteria, so it is very important to properly maintain intimate hygiene.
